from setuptools import setup, find_packages
with open('README_PyPI.md', 'r', encoding='utf-8') as f:
long_description = f.read()
setup(
name='beliefppg',
version='0.3.1',
packages=find_packages(),
package_data={'beliefppg': ['inference/inference_model_architecture.json', 'inference/inference_model_weights.npz',
'inference/inference_model_notimebackbone_architecture.json', 'inference/inference_model_notimebackbone_weights.npz']},
install_requires=[
'numpy',
'pandas',
'scikit-learn',
'tensorflow>=2.14.0',
'tf-keras',
'tensorflow-probability~=0.22.1',
'wandb'
],
python_requires='>=3.9',
author='Paul Streli',
author_email='[email protected]',
description='Taking multi-channel PPG and Accelerometer signals as input, BeliefPPG predicts the instantaneous heart rate and provides an uncertainty estimate for the prediction.',
long_description=long_description,
long_description_content_type='text/markdown',
url='https://github.com/eth-siplab/BeliefPPG',
classifiers=[
'Development Status :: 4 - Beta',
'Intended Audience :: Developers',
'License :: OSI Approved :: MIT License',
'Programming Language :: Python :: 3',
'Programming Language :: Python :: 3.9',
'Programming Language :: Python :: 3.10',
'Programming Language :: Python :: 3.11',
'Programming Language :: Python :: 3.12',
'Topic :: Software Development :: Libraries'
],
keywords='PPG, heart rate, signal processing, uncertainty estimation, biomedical signals',
)
